Visão Geral
TextBlob é uma biblioteca Python NLP para processamento de dados textuais. Ele fornece uma API simples que facilita a execução de tarefas de NLP, como marcação de parte do discurso, extração de frase nominal, análise de sentimento, classificação, tradução etc.
Objetivo
Após realizar este Curso, você será capaz de:
- Configure o ambiente de desenvolvimento necessário para começar a implementar tarefas NLP com TextBlob.
- Entenda os recursos, a arquitetura e as vantagens do TextBlob.
- Aprenda a construir sistemas de classificação de texto usando TextBlob.
- Execute tarefas comuns de NLP (tokenização, WordNet, análise de sentimentos, correção ortográfica, etc.)
- Execute implementações avançadas com APIs simples e algumas linhas de códigos.
Formato do Curso
- Palestra e discussão interativa.
- Muitos exercícios e prática.
- Implementação prática em um ambiente de laboratório ao vivo.
Opções de personalização do curso
- Para solicitar um treinamento personalizado para este curso, entre em contato conosco para agendar.
Publico Alvo
- cientistas de dados
- Desenvolvedores
Pre-Requisitos
- Uma compreensão dos conceitos de PNL
- Experiência em programação Python
Materiais
Português/Inglês + Exercícios + Lab Pratico
Conteúdo Programatico
Introduction
- Overview of TextBlob features and architecture
- NLP fundamentals
Getting Started
- Installing TextBlob
- Importing libraries and data
Building Text Classification Models
- Loading data and creating classifiers
- Evaluating classifiers
- Updating classifiers with new data
- Using feature extractors
Performing NLP Tasks using TextBlob
- Tokenization
- WordNet integration
- Noun phrase extraction
- Part-of-speech tagging
- Sentiment analysis
- Spelling correction
- Translation and language detection
APIs and Advanced Implementations
- Sentiment analyzers
- Tokenizers
- Noun phrase chunkers
- POS taggers
- Parsers
- Blobber
TENHO INTERESSE